Albert Nzabonaliba, fms

 


Participant (Delegate)
Rwanda - East Central Africa

Br. Albert, from the Central-East Africa Province, entered the novitiate in 1984 and made his first profession in 1986 at SAVE (Rwanda), where he also made his final vows in 1991. A teacher and formator, he studied at the Salesian Pontifical University in Rome. He has served in formation houses in Rwanda, Tanzania, and Kenya, and held roles such as scholasticate director, formator, and superior at the Marist International Centre (MIC – Nairobi). He was also principal of the Marist International University College. He currently serves as Deputy Vice-Chancellor of the Catholic University of Rwanda.
